中國能源利用結(jié)構(gòu)優(yōu)化的技術(shù)創(chuàng)新能力貢獻:理論與實證

【摘要】:在中國經(jīng)濟高速發(fā)展過程中亟需優(yōu)化能源利用結(jié)構(gòu),這其中技術(shù)創(chuàng)新能力有何貢獻呢?簡要的理論分析能夠大致了解兩者之間的關(guān)系,建立一個四方程聯(lián)立系統(tǒng)并利用中國經(jīng)驗證據(jù)進行實證檢驗來估計技術(shù)創(chuàng)新能力對中國能源利用結(jié)構(gòu)優(yōu)化的貢獻。實證結(jié)果顯示,在其他條件不變情況下,技術(shù)創(chuàng)新能力水平提升1%,中國煤炭消費占比將平均下降0.732%。從中國不同地區(qū)之間的差異性來看,在其他條件不變情況下,創(chuàng)新能力水平每提升1%,發(fā)達地區(qū)煤炭消費占比卻要增加1.097%,而經(jīng)濟欠發(fā)達地區(qū)煤炭消費占比可平均下降1.026%。因此,在中國省際之間利用技術(shù)創(chuàng)新能力促進資源利用結(jié)構(gòu)優(yōu)化需要區(qū)別對待。
[Abstract]:In the process of China's rapid economic development, it is urgent to optimize the structure of energy utilization. What contribution does the ability of technological innovation make? A brief theoretical analysis can roughly understand the relationship between the two and establish a four-equation simultaneous system and empirical test based on Chinese empirical evidence to estimate the contribution of technological innovation to the optimization of energy use structure in China. The empirical results show that under other conditions, the level of technological innovation ability will be improved by 1%, and the proportion of coal consumption in China will decrease by 0.73 2% on average. From the point of view of the difference between different regions in China, if the level of innovation ability is raised by 1, the proportion of coal consumption in developed areas will increase by 1.097, while the proportion of coal consumption in less developed areas can be decreased by 1.026% on average. Therefore, the utilization of technological innovation ability to promote the optimization of resource utilization structure among provinces in China needs to be treated differently.
